Latest Patents

Woo-Joung Kim holds a patent for a stacked memory device, which includes an optical proximity correction (OPC) verifying method. This method involves checking the first location of a first pattern in the layout of a stacked memory device. It calculates a shift value of the first pattern according to its location and obtains a difference value between the first location and a second location of a second pattern formed through OPC. The method determines whether the OPC needs to be performed again based on the shift value and the difference value.
